10 Things In Tech You Need To Know Today

Marissa Mayer
Marissa Mayer

REUTERS/Ruben Sprich Marissa Mayer, Chief Executive Officer of Yahoo speaks during a session at the World Economic Forum (WEF) in Davos January 25, 2014.

Happy 2015! It's going to be sunny, and cool in New York. Here's the tech news you need to know going into the weekend.

1. Marissa Mayer is considering buying a cable network. Yahoo considered acquiring Scripps Networks Interactive.

2. Who is Rony Abovitz? Google led a $542 million investment in his company. We have a long profile looking at who he is and where he came frome.

3. Elon Musk is getting divorced for a second time. He's giving his wife $16 million in cash as part of their financial settlement.

4. Snapchat revealed on New Year's Eve that it raised $486 million in funding. It was revealed in an SEC filing.

5. It looks like the FBI made an embarrassing mistake in its investigation of the Sony hack. The bureau may have sent out a bulletin based on a prank.

6. Google is planning on building a massive campus in Colorado. Locals are worried about gentrification.

7. Uber is suspending operations in Spain. A Spanish court launched an injunction against the company.

8. A new study says that over 80% of dark web traffic is to child porn sites. The study looked at traffic over a six month period.

9. Hackers have leaked a crucial part of the Xbox One's software. It could be used to release homemade games for free.

10. India has blocked a load of popular websites because of threats from ISIS. Dailymotion, Vimeo and GitHub are all blocked.
